Transaction cff53bb20601a68b59c6486b8a2b2f957ee7c3e1561658431579701689e26fb5
1 Input
2 Outputs
- cff53bb20601a68b59c6486b8a2b2f957ee7c3e1561658431579701689e26fb5:0
- cff53bb20601a68b59c6486b8a2b2f957ee7c3e1561658431579701689e26fb5:1
value 827000
address 336zSewatUHjJSpjsdCffHP4LwYZjD4Dvd
value 743011502
address 1CFXRuYBthCnMWJ9t1F37yEJEyLP1Uc52b